MySQL,作为开源数据库管理系统中的佼佼者,以其高性能、稳定性和广泛的社区支持,早已成为众多企业应用的首选
而当MySQL与云计算的强大能力相结合时,不仅继承了MySQL的所有优点,还赋予了数据库更高的灵活性、可扩展性和成本效益,为企业数据管理与存储带来了革命性的变革
一、云端数据库的优势:灵活性与可扩展性的飞跃 传统本地部署的MySQL数据库,虽然功能强大,但在面对快速变化的市场需求和业务规模扩张时,往往显得力不从心
硬件升级、容量规划、故障恢复等运维工作不仅耗时耗力,还可能成为企业发展的瓶颈
相比之下,基于MySQL的云端数据库则彻底打破了这些限制
1. 弹性伸缩,即时响应 云端数据库能够根据业务负载自动调整资源分配,无论是突发流量还是季节性高峰,都能确保数据库性能的稳定与高效
这种弹性伸缩的能力,使得企业无需提前预测并过度配置资源,大大节省了成本
2. 高可用性,无缝切换 云计算平台提供的多副本部署、自动故障转移机制,确保了云端MySQL数据库的高可用性
即使单个节点发生故障,也能迅速切换到备用节点,保证服务不间断,这对于关键业务应用尤为重要
3. 全球部署,低延迟访问 借助云服务商的全球数据中心网络,企业可以轻松实现数据库的跨区域、跨国部署,确保用户无论身处何地都能享受到低延迟的数据访问体验,这对于提升用户体验、拓展国际市场具有重要意义
二、成本效益:从资本支出到运营支出的转变 对于许多中小企业而言,高昂的硬件购置与维护成本是阻碍其采用先进数据库技术的一大障碍
基于MySQL的云端数据库采用按需付费模式,企业只需根据实际使用情况支付费用,无需一次性投入大量资金
这种从资本支出(CapEx)向运营支出(OpEx)的转变,不仅降低了初期投入门槛,还使得企业能够更灵活地调整预算,专注于核心业务的发展
三、安全与合规:云端数据库的坚实后盾 数据安全与合规性是企业选择数据库解决方案时必须考虑的关键因素
基于MySQL的云端数据库通过多层次的安全措施,为企业数据保驾护航
1. 加密传输与存储 云端数据库支持数据的端到端加密传输,以及静态数据加密存储,有效防止数据在传输和存储过程中的泄露风险
2. 精细访问控制 通过基于角色的访问控制(RBAC)、多因素认证(MFA)等机制,企业可以实现对数据库访问的精细化管理,确保只有授权用户才能访问敏感数据
3. 合规认证 主流云服务商的MySQL云端数据库服务通常已获得多项国际安全与合规认证,如ISO27001、SOC2、GDPR等,帮助企业轻松满足国内外各种监管要求
四、开发与运维:提升效率,简化流程 基于MySQL的云端数据库,凭借其丰富的开发工具、自动化运维特性,极大地提升了开发团队与运维团队的工作效率
1. 开发工具集成 大多数云数据库服务都提供了与主流开发框架、IDE的深度集成,支持自动化迁移工具、数据库设计工具等,加速了应用的开发周期
2. 自动化运维 云端数据库内置了监控、备份、恢复、升级等一系列自动化运维功能,大大减轻了运维团队的工作负担,使得他们能够将更多精力投入到业务优化和创新上
3. 智能诊断与优化 借助AI和机器学习技术,云端数据库能够自动识别性能瓶颈、提出优化建议,甚至自动执行优化操作,进一步提升数据库的整体性能和稳定性
五、案例分析:云端MySQL数据库的成功实践 -电商巨头:某知名电商平台通过迁移到基于MySQL的云端数据库,成功应对了“双十一”等大促期间的流量洪峰,实现了秒级扩容,保证了用户购物体验的流畅
-金融科技:一家金融科技公司采用云端MySQL数据库存储敏感金融数据,通过数据加密、访问控制等措施,确保了数据的安全合规,同时利用云的弹性扩展能力快速响应市场变化
-在线教育:随着在线教育的兴起,一家教育平台利用云端MySQL数据库支撑了数百万用户的并发访问,通过自动备份与恢复功能保障了教学资料的安全,降低了运维成本
六、展望未来:持续创新与融合 随着云计算技术的不断进步,基于MySQL的云端数据库也在持续演进
未来,我们可以期待更多创新特性的加入,如更智能的自动化运维、更深度的数据分析与洞察能力、以及与人工智能、大数据等技术的深度融合,共同推动企业数字化转型的深入发展
总之,基于MySQL的云端数据库以其无可比拟的优势,正逐步成为企业数据管理与存储的首选方案
它不仅解决了传统数据库面临的诸多挑战,还为企业带来了前所未有的灵活性、可扩展性和成本效益,助力企业在数字化时代中乘风破浪,稳健前行